Ersodetug missed its phase 3 primary endpoint in congenital HI, but FDA is reviewing CGM data showing 50%+ hypoglycemia reductions.

Rezolute provided an update on the ongoing FDA review of data from its phase 3 sunRIZE study of ersodetug for congenital hyperinsulinism (HI), after the trial did not meet its primary endpoint of reducing hypoglycemia events compared with placebo, the company announced September 9, 2026.¹

Key facts

  • Drug: Ersodetug (RZ358; Rezolute)
  • Class: Fully human monoclonal antibody; allosteric insulin receptor binder
  • Indication studied: HI
  • Trial: Phase 3 sunRIZE (RZ358-301); 63 patients
  • Result: Missed primary and key secondary endpoints vs placebo
  • Secondary signal: 50%+ reductions in CGM-based hypoglycemia measures in some analyses
  • Regulatory status: FDA independently reviewing additional data; no set timeline
  • Disease burden: Estimated minimum incidence ~1 in 28,389 live births (UK data)
  • Pipeline context: Phase 3 upLIFT trial (tumor HI) topline results expected by end of 2026

Following a March 2026 meeting, FDA requested additional data focused on continuous glucose monitoring (CGM)-based outcomes, which Rezolute submitted in June 2026. The agency has since indicated it is still reviewing the submission to evaluate a potential regulatory path forward, without a specific timeline for feedback.¹

What did the sunRIZE trial show?

sunRIZE (RZ358-301) was a phase 3, multicenter, double-blind, randomized, placebo-controlled trial that enrolled 63 participants ages 3 months to 45 years with congenital HI experiencing continued hypoglycemia despite standard-of-care therapy. Participants received ersodetug at 5 mg/kg, 10 mg/kg, or matched placebo added to existing standard of care. The trial did not meet its primary endpoint (weekly hypoglycemia events) or key secondary endpoint (percent time in hypoglycemia by CGM), with reductions from baseline that were not statistically significant compared with placebo at the week 24 evaluation window.¹

Larger, often nominally significant glycemic improvements versus placebo were observed throughout the maintenance dosing phase across numerous CGM-based endpoints, including 50% or greater reductions in average daily percent time in hypoglycemia and average weekly hypoglycemia events at both dose levels in some analyses.¹

What is the status of FDA's review?

At a March 2026 Type B meeting, FDA acknowledged challenges posed by behavioral factors in this patient population, including limitations of self-monitored blood glucose-based hypoglycemia measures, and requested additional data for independent review.¹ In June 2026, Rezolute submitted source and analysis datasets and summary results from pre-specified, post-hoc, and sensitivity analyses focused on CGM-based outcomes from the trial's pivotal portion. Because this review is occurring outside FDA's customary formal meeting process, no specific timeline exists for feedback or alignment on next steps, and Rezolute said it retains the ability to request a formal meeting if needed.¹

What longer-term data does Rezolute have?

An open-label extension phase of sunRIZE is ongoing, with high participant retention and cumulative ersodetug treatment duration ranging from approximately 9 months to more than 2 years, along with a reduction in background standard-of-care therapy use that the company said may indicate continued benefit with longer-term treatment.¹ In an earlier phase 2b trial of 23 patients, ersodetug (also known as RZ358) reduced hypoglycemia events by a median of 59% and time in hypoglycemia by a median of 54% compared with baseline, both statistically significant, with no deaths or study withdrawals reported.²

Why is a new treatment needed for congenital HI, and what's next?

Congenital HI is a rare, primarily pediatric disease caused by dysregulated insulin secretion that can lead to persistent, severe hypoglycemia and lifelong neurologic impairment. A UK-based study estimated a minimum incidence of about 1 in 28,389 live births.³ Ersodetug is a fully human monoclonal antibody that allosterically binds the insulin receptor to reduce overactivation by insulin and related substances, an approach Rezolute said has potential across multiple forms of hyperinsulinism.¹ Separately, the company is continuing to enroll patients in its phase 3 upLIFT trial of ersodetug for tumor HI and remains on track to report topline results before the end of 2026.¹

What are the limitations?

The sunRIZE trial did not meet its primary or key secondary endpoint, and the CGM-based improvements described come from post-hoc and sensitivity analyses rather than the trial's confirmed primary results. In addition, FDA has not indicated whether these data will be sufficient to support a regulatory path forward. No timeline for its decision has been provided.
